With the price of 24-karat gold rising by Rs5,100 per tola to Rs454,336.
KARACHI: Gold and silver prices continued their upward trend on Friday, with gold posting gains for a third consecutive trading session amid a sharp increase in international bullion markets.
In the global bullion market, gold rose by $51 per ounce to $4,319, providing further momentum to precious metal prices worldwide.
Silver prices also climbed in international markets, where the metal gained $2.80 per ounce to reach $64.60.
